.. _file_SeQuant_core_io_serialization_v1_deserialize.cpp: File deserialize.cpp ==================== |exhale_lsh| :ref:`Parent directory ` (``SeQuant/core/io/serialization/v1``) .. |exhale_lsh| unicode:: U+021B0 .. UPWARDS ARROW WITH TIP LEFTWARDS .. contents:: Contents :local: :backlinks: none Definition (``SeQuant/core/io/serialization/v1/deserialize.cpp``) ----------------------------------------------------------------- .. toctree:: :maxdepth: 1 program_listing_file_SeQuant_core_io_serialization_v1_deserialize.cpp.rst Includes -------- - ``SeQuant/core/attr.hpp`` (:ref:`file_SeQuant_core_attr.hpp`) - ``SeQuant/core/container.hpp`` (:ref:`file_SeQuant_core_container.hpp`) - ``SeQuant/core/expr.hpp`` (:ref:`file_SeQuant_core_expr.hpp`) - ``SeQuant/core/index.hpp`` (:ref:`file_SeQuant_core_index.hpp`) - ``SeQuant/core/io/serialization/serialization.hpp`` (:ref:`file_SeQuant_core_io_serialization_serialization.hpp`) - ``SeQuant/core/io/serialization/v1/ast.hpp`` (:ref:`file_SeQuant_core_io_serialization_v1_ast.hpp`) - ``SeQuant/core/io/serialization/v1/ast_conversions.hpp`` (:ref:`file_SeQuant_core_io_serialization_v1_ast_conversions.hpp`) - ``SeQuant/core/io/serialization/v1/semantic_actions.hpp`` (:ref:`file_SeQuant_core_io_serialization_v1_semantic_actions.hpp`) - ``SeQuant/core/space.hpp`` (:ref:`file_SeQuant_core_space.hpp`) - ``algorithm`` (:ref:`file_SeQuant_core_algorithm.hpp`) - ``boost/core/demangle.hpp`` - ``boost/spirit/home/x3.hpp`` - ``boost/spirit/home/x3/support/utility/error_reporting.hpp`` - ``boost/variant.hpp`` - ``cassert`` - ``cstddef`` - ``functional`` - ``iterator`` - ``optional`` - ``string`` (:ref:`file_SeQuant_core_utility_string.cpp`) - ``string_view`` - ``utility`` (:ref:`file_SeQuant_core_utility_atomic.hpp`) - ``vector`` Namespaces ---------- - :ref:`namespace_sequant` - :ref:`namespace_sequant__io` - :ref:`namespace_sequant__io__serialization` - :ref:`namespace_sequant__io__serialization__v1` - :ref:`namespace_sequant__io__serialization__v1__parse` - :ref:`namespace_sequant__io__serialization__v1__parse__helpers` Classes ------- -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_error_handler`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_expr_rule`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1helpers_1_1annotate__position`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1helpers_1_1error__handler`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_index_group_rule`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_index_label_rule`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_index_rule`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_number_rule`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_product_rule`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_result_rule`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_sum_rule`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_symmetry_spec_rule`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_tensor_rule` - :ref:`exhale_struct_structsequant_1_1io_1_1serialization_1_1v1_1_1parse_1_1_variable_rule` Functions --------- - :ref:`exhale_function_namespacesequant_1_1io_1_1serialization_1_1v1_1a85186c6c97a568a48c13498b7fe585e1` - :ref:`exhale_function_namespacesequant_1_1io_1_1serialization_1_1v1_1a7ac15caf3ce1bc1cc4521404c646170d` - :ref:`exhale_function_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a24d5e06203598d49f06cc928544d16c5` - :ref:`exhale_function_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a50b2364c46b0f8e0a786f591d2765ade` - :ref:`exhale_function_namespacesequant_1_1io_1_1serialization_1_1v1_1a04568bac51bd90f34539b5bd75b5f048` - :ref:`exhale_function_namespacesequant_1_1io_1_1serialization_1_1v1_1a013b64aeaef41a87e48b4eed50753ccc` Defines ------- - :ref:`exhale_define_deserialize_8cpp_1a4d6f7f1e18b9eab7b16fe0f0b6ebe5df` - :ref:`exhale_define_deserialize_8cpp_1aaa703a8d1860285647b13a1bf9a81b40` Variables --------- -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a64bb9eb3c5ebf87ec703f074f53d4dbf`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a83ada5f3a103b2772c17f235a350093c`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a26e6c1cc778a121f844a7bafba2724a4`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1ae78e330b2c85807d62445a80e78ba722`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1afffc7bc32519454757bd206885e42ae8`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1afee12e03d7996739d463b1c225ea5d73`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a394a3c0d7970aa8b210ad6686c2c24a5`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a72c282fe4ebc77087f7a104743316af9`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a2ef9d650b95886b1a3823571027b7fb5`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a436ae226c9b9729d395ccf600d63134d`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1ad6c593d511dac035c6f39723d16e06a9`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a57fbca9884d28b3906254475272be593`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a49e0aadd799e62348513353cff2aae3f`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1aec71ea8199f774c39871edb53f020b81`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a4faec041223c585355768d65327bc0d4`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a64eeb7940f45e25affd3064f5b89567d`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a07df8c8878d8651c756437b89d3c2cf3`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a0154a2238b93990fdad86ea5cc4b9877`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a60f8d9634b0cba6f8f33e784dae22bb6`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a79359f9f492791d226ad10e9d324de04`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a36c1de9281963898e1d74ae2c4e4c40b`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a20e49ef984fce5570d91d0018d65317b`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a48a1b60826353a172d80e41be11c396c`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a7944f5d200c371fda5bac08be37d351a`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a5125dc87ef8758e92dbc314c84e1ea60`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a909599677ea6f3df07f03669c19efcf9`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1ae5b8e562d6216d13dc58fbce56faaaa3`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a0f50ec216e7730cb7d14dc756c281506`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a9e8784828bda86c5cf9b513d578ffd40`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1a39dbfce8cae1131598f5f9aa94381bb0`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1aaa9ddcea938eff07475dbb9ad9a22d41` - :ref:`exhale_variable_namespacesequant_1_1io_1_1serialization_1_1v1_1_1parse_1ad8fd96b486ae08915fcf5fbe2d24b838`